British Vogue & Tatler

Velia Sierra Design proudly represents Mexican fashion now in Great Britain. With this, we undoubtedly take a fundamental step on our path to enter the European fashion market.

The British edition of Vogue included our brand in the Retail section for the numbers of June, July and August 2019. Additionally,Tatler Magazine also invited his readers to meet us in its June edition of this year.

The September edition, the most important in the year for Condé Nast and Vogue Magazine (and in general for the fashion world), she had as guest editor Meghan Markle (Duchess of Sussex). The edition titled “Forces of Change” celebrates the participation of women to make a positive change in society and included fifteen celebrities from around the world, including Salma Hayek, Laverne Cox and Jane Fonda.
